#b70ab2 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#b70ab2 is composed of 71.8% red, 3.9%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 301.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 37.8%. #b70ab2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ff14ff with #6f0065.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#b70ab2 color description : Strong magenta.

The hexadecimal color #b70ab2 has RGB values of R:183, G:10,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.03,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 11995826.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10010f is the darkest color, while #fffcff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#655c65 is the less saturated color, while #be03b9 is the most saturated one.
